Mangaluru: Burglary at Uma Maheshwari Temple, Attavar


Mangalore Today News Network

Mangaluru, Aug 4, 2016: Thieves who broke into the Uma Maheshwari Temple at Attavar in the city on August 3, Wednesday night have decamped with silver ornaments worth over Rs 2 lakhs.

The thieves had  broken the main door  locks to enter the temple and have  stolen the Kavachas of the presiding deity Shiva apart from the silver ornaments on the idols of Lord Ganapathi, Krishna and Vishnumurthi.

The thieves were clever enough to destroy two CCTV cameras. They had also covered yet another CCTV camera with a cloth so that their act was not caught on camera.

Pandeshwar police have rushed to the temple along with dog squad and finger print experts.
